I actually read his autobiography years ago - "Snake" - and remember being amused by the fact that, while he was in Houston, there was a brief flirtation with a locally-made soft drink called "Snake Venom". It bombed, but Stabler was cool with it - he himself said it tasted pretty much like it sounded. He was on SNL, "Married With Children" and a couple other shows in a guest role too, and he even had a children's book out there, I believe.

He had a reputation of being a badass tough guy. Stabler used to study the playbook at nightclubs and felt obligated to enjoy his female fans. One of the best QBs ever in the clutch/4th quarter(probably because last nights booze was worn off by then). A lot of people don't know that the "Immaculate Reception" happened right after Stabler had scored the then go ahead touchdown. Before he tore up his knees was an elite mobile QB too.
